Benjamin, a rising star filmmaker, is on the brink of premiering his difficult second film No Self at the London Film Festival when Billie, his hard drinking publicist, introduces him to a mesmeric French musician called Noah.

A charming, introspective portrait of a self-aware filmmaker confronting his own emotional blocks through an unexpected romance. It's tender and gently funny, more interested in the messy feelings between two people than plot mechanics.
